| /**
 | |
|  * Implementation based on Legendre-Gauss quadrature for more accurate arc
 | |
|  * length calculation.
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* Reference: https://pomax.github.io/bezierinfo/#arclength
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* @param c The curve to calculate the length of
 | |
|  * @returns The approximated length of the curve
 | |
|  */
 | |
| export function curveLength<P extends GlobalPoint | LocalPoint>(
 | |
|   c: Curve<P>,
 | |
| ): number {
 | |
|   const z2 = 0.5;
 | |
|   let sum = 0;
 | |
| 
 | |
|   for (let i = 0; i < 24; i++) {
 | |
|     const t = z2 * LegendreGaussN24TValues[i] + z2;
 | |
|     const derivativeVector = curveTangent(c, t);
 | |
|     const magnitude = Math.sqrt(
 | |
|       derivativeVector[0] * derivativeVector[0] +
 | |
|         derivativeVector[1] * derivativeVector[1],
 | |
|     );
 | |
|     sum += LegendreGaussN24CValues[i] * magnitude;
 | |
|   }
 | |
| 
 | |
|   return z2 * sum;
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| /**
 | |
|  * Calculates the curve length from t=0 to t=parameter using the same
 | |
|  * Legendre-Gauss quadrature method used in curveLength
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* @param c The curve to calculate the partial length for
 | |
|  * @param t The parameter value (0 to 1) to calculate length up to
 | |
|  * @returns The length of the curve from beginning to parameter t
 | |
|  */
 | |
| export function curveLengthAtParameter<P extends GlobalPoint | LocalPoint>(
 | |
|   c: Curve<P>,
 | |
|   t: number,
 | |
| ): number {
 | |
|   if (t <= 0) {
 | |
|     return 0;
 | |
|   }
 | |
|   if (t >= 1) {
 | |
|     return curveLength(c);
 | |
|   }
 | |
| 
 | |
|   // Scale and shift the integration interval from [0,t] to [-1,1]
 | |
|   // which is what the Legendre-Gauss quadrature expects
 | |
|   const z1 = t / 2;
 | |
|   const z2 = t / 2;
 | |
| 
 | |
|   let sum = 0;
 | |
| 
 | |
|   for (let i = 0; i < 24; i++) {
 | |
|     const parameter = z1 * LegendreGaussN24TValues[i] + z2;
 | |
|     const derivativeVector = curveTangent(c, parameter);
 | |
|     const magnitude = Math.sqrt(
 | |
|       derivativeVector[0] * derivativeVector[0] +
 | |
|         derivativeVector[1] * derivativeVector[1],
 | |
|     );
 | |
|     sum += LegendreGaussN24CValues[i] * magnitude;
 | |
|   }
 | |
| 
 | |
|   return z1 * sum; // Scale the result back to the original interval
 | |
| }

| /**
 | |
|  * Calculates the point at a specific percentage of a curve's total length
 | |
|  * using binary search for improved efficiency and accuracy.
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* @param c The curve to calculate point on
 | |
|  * @param percent A value between 0 and 1 representing the percentage of the curve's length
 | |
|  * @returns The point at the specified percentage of curve length
 | |
|  */
 | |
| export function curvePointAtLength<P extends GlobalPoint | LocalPoint>(
 | |
|   c: Curve<P>,
 | |
|   percent: number,
 | |
| ): P {
 | |
|   if (percent <= 0) {
 | |
|     return bezierEquation(c, 0);
 | |
|   }
 | |
| 
 | |
|   if (percent >= 1) {
 | |
|     return bezierEquation(c, 1);
 | |
|   }
 | |
| 
 | |
|   const totalLength = curveLength(c);
 | |
|   const targetLength = totalLength * percent;
 | |
| 
 | |
|   // Binary search to find parameter t where length at t equals target length
 | |
|   let tMin = 0;
 | |
|   let tMax = 1;
 | |
|   let t = percent; // Start with a reasonable guess (t = percent)
 | |
|   let currentLength = 0;
 | |
| 
 | |
|   // Tolerance for length comparison and iteration limit to avoid infinite loops
 | |
|   const tolerance = totalLength * 0.0001;
 | |
|   const maxIterations = 20;
 | |
| 
 | |
|   for (let iteration = 0; iteration < maxIterations; iteration++) {
 | |
|     currentLength = curveLengthAtParameter(c, t);
 | |
|     const error = Math.abs(currentLength - targetLength);
 | |
| 
 | |
|     if (error < tolerance) {
 | |
|       break;
 | |
|     }
 | |
| 
 | |
|     if (currentLength < targetLength) {
 | |
|       tMin = t;
 | |
|     } else {
 | |
|       tMax = t;
 | |
|     }
 | |
| 
 | |
|     t = (tMin + tMax) / 2;
 | |
|   }
 | |
| 
 | |
|   return bezierEquation(c, t);
 | |
| }
